EPA v. BIA Chemawa Indian School PWS (FF)

Final Order No Penalty

Case summary

EPA issued a SDWA order to BIA for SDWA violations at the BIA Chemawa Indian School Public Water System due to high levels of copper level in the drinking water. The order will require BIA to select an appropriate corrosion control treatment, submit that recommendation to EPA, and, once approved, begin installation of the treatment to lower the copper levels.
